Ticket: Expired credential breaks timezone conversion in report exports

Plugin authors relying on the Chronoseam export pipeline will see UTC-only timestamps because the timezone lookup service rejected our expired credential last night. Conversions silently fall back rather than erroring, so verify recent exports carefully. A replacement has been issued; the new key appears below.

gateway credential: kto23_LX9A4ys6i4nzHtpOLNLodKK

Facilities Ticket — Cleaning Crew Access, Brindle Annex

For new starters handling evening lock-up: the Sorano Cleaning crew arrives nightly at 21:30 via the annex side door. Check their rota sheet, note arrival in the log, and ensure the storeroom is relocked afterward. To let them through the side door, enter the access code below.

badge for yaweg-hafog: bdg-GX-6

**Handover: EXIF Scrubbing Pipeline (Project Tidemark)**

Handing off the EXIF scrubbing service ahead of my rotation. Current state: GPS and serial-number tags are stripped on upload; orientation tags are preserved and reapplied after transcode. Known gap: embedded thumbnails in some RAW formats still carry location data — tracked as a P2. Deployment is weekly, canary first. Runbook and test fixtures are linked in the team wiki. Ongoing ownership and sign-off now sit with the engineer named below.

named custodian: Brivan Eliath Quenox Frador